Abstract

In Next Generation Home network Environment (NGHE), multimedia service will be a key concept of advanced intelligent and secure services which are different from the existing ones. In this paper, we propose a Hybrid Intelligent Multimedia Service Framework (HIMSF) which is mixed with application technologies like intelligent home Infrastructure or multimedia protection management through the ubiquitous sensor network based technology to provide a proper multimedia service suitable for NGHE. The proposed framework provides an inter-operability among heterogeneous equipments regarding home network appliances like wireless devices, electronic appliances, PC. In addition, it provides adaptive application services.
